Too many connections my.cnf
时间: 2024-05-30 19:06:14 浏览: 18
"Too many connections"是指MySQL服务器中的并发连接数已达到最大值,无法再接受新的连接请求。这通常是由于应用程序在短时间内发起大量的连接请求,或者MySQL服务器配置不足以处理大量连接的情况导致的。为了解决这个问题,可以通过以下方式进行调整:
1. 增加MySQL服务器的最大连接数限制,可以在my.cnf文件中设置max_connections参数,该参数默认值为151,建议根据实际情况进行调整。
2. 优化应用程序代码,减少不必要的连接请求。可以考虑使用连接池技术来管理数据库连接。
3. 优化MySQL服务器的配置参数,如增加缓存区大小等,以提高服务器的处理能力。
相关问题
[08004][1040] Data source rejected establishment of connection, message from server: "Too many connections".
这个错误提示表明数据库连接数已经达到了最大值,无法再建立新的连接。解决这个问题的方法是增加数据库的最大连接数。可以通过修改数据库的配置文件或者在命令行中执行SQL语句来实现。以下是两种方法:
1. 修改数据库配置文件
找到MySQL的配置文件my.cnf(或者my.ini),在[mysqld]下添加或修改max_connections参数的值,例如将其设置为1000:
```
[mysqld]
max_connections=1000
```
保存文件后重启MySQL服务即可生效。
2. 在命令行中执行SQL语句
可以使用以下命令来设置最大连接数为1000,并查看当前最大连接数:
```sql
set global max_connections=1000;
show variables like "max_connections";
```
需要注意的是,这种方法只对当前会话有效,重启MySQL服务后会失效。如果想要永久生效,还需要修改MySQL的配置文件。
java.sql.SQLNonTransientConnectionException: Too many connections
这个错误通常是由于连接到MySQL数据库的客户端数量超过了MySQL服务器的最大连接数限制所导致的。当MySQL服务器达到最大连接数时,它将拒绝新的连接请求并抛出“java.sql.SQLNonTransientConnectionException: Too many connections”异常。
解决这个问题的方法是增加MySQL服务器的最大连接数限制。可以通过以下两种方式来实现:
1. 临增加最大连接数限制:可以使用以下命令将最大连接数限制增加到1000:
```sql
set global max_connections=1000;
```
这个命令将在MySQL服务器重启后失效。
2. 永久增加最大连接数限制:可以编辑MySQL服务器的配置文件my.cnf,在[mysqld]部分添加以下行:
```ini
max_connections=1000
```
然后重启MySQL服务器使更改生效。
相关推荐
![cnf](https://img-home.csdnimg.cn/images/20210720083646.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)